Ethnic Minority Language Contest 2026

On the morning of March 24th, the Provincial Border Guard Command organized the opening ceremony of the 2026 Ethnic Minority Language Contest.

The opening ceremony was attended by representatives of the leadership of the Provincial Border Guard Command and specialized departments and divisions under the Provincial Border Guard Command.

Delegates and contestants attend the opening ceremony.

The competition involved 52 contestants, divided into 13 teams of 4 members each. The contestants competed in two categories: speaking and writing in the Hmong language.

The 2026 Ethnic Minority Language Competition aims to enhance the proficiency of officers and soldiers in using ethnic minority languages ​​while performing their duties. This will contribute to improving the effectiveness of propaganda and mobilization efforts, building close military-civilian relations, and maintaining political security and social order in border areas. The competition serves as an opportunity to assess the quality of learning and training, facilitate exchange of experiences, and select teams to participate in the regional competition. Furthermore, the competition will select a team to participate in the regional competition organized by the Command Headquarters in Lao Cai province in the near future.

Candidates are taking the Hmong language speaking skills test.

The competition is scheduled to conclude on March 25th. At the end of the competition, the Organizing Committee will award first, second, and third prizes to the teams and individuals with outstanding achievements.
